Buyers Guide: Choosing an AI Content Creation Tool

What to look for before you buy

Are you trying to ship more blog posts, improve landing page conversion, or reduce turnaround time for social campaigns? Clear goals help you compare AI Content Creation Tool features like workflow automation, editing controls, and content templates without getting distracted by flashy demos. It also helps you estimate the right level of human review and how much time you can realistically save.

Next, look for a tool that supports structured content creation rather than one-off text generation. The best options make it easy to plan topics, create briefs, generate drafts, and standardize formatting across your brand voice. Automation should handle repetitive steps such as outlining, repurposing copy, and preparing assets for review. A buyer-intent checklist should also include export formats, collaboration options, and whether the tool integrates with the systems you already use for publishing and project tracking.

Assess quality, control, and compliance

Buyers often focus on speed, but quality gates matter just as much. Check whether the platform provides consistent tone, clear rewriting controls, and the ability to refine sections without starting from scratch. Look for features that reduce common issues like Automate Content Creation with AI Tools generic phrasing, mismatched brand terminology, and missing details. If your content relies on specific product facts or compliance requirements, prioritize tools that let you manage reference material and prompt the model with reliable context.

Control is also a practical purchase criterion. You want guardrails that make it easier to stay on-brand and reduce back-and-forth with editors. Consider whether the system supports approval workflows, versioning, and audit-friendly exports for internal stakeholders. If your organization is subject to legal or industry standards, assess how the tool handles citations, claims, and regulated language so your team can review confidently before publishing.

Match features to your content workflow

For example, if your team starts with keyword research and briefs, choose a platform that can generate outlines and draft sections from structured inputs. If your workflow relies on repurposing existing assets, prioritize tools that can convert long-form content into email drafts, social posts, and short landing page sections while preserving messaging. The goal is to eliminate manual busywork while keeping strategic decisions in human hands.

It’s also worth evaluating project management support and collaboration. If you manage multiple campaigns, you need a way to keep drafts organized, track status, and ensure everyone follows the same standards. Look for options that help you batch tasks, reuse templates, and maintain consistency across authors and departments. Buyers should test whether the tool can handle different content types such as product descriptions, thought leadership articles, and marketing emails without forcing you into one rigid style.
